(Bountiful, UT) — The wife of President Henry B. Eyring, Kathleen Eyring, has died at age 82. Henry B. Eyring is the Second Counselor in the First Presidency of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. He met Kathleen back in 1961 and married her the following year. She was very active in the church, teaching lessons and producing a newsletter for her congregation among other duties. According to the Church, she passed away in Bountiful yesterday morning surrounded by friends and family. Funeral arrangements for Eyring are currently pending.
